3 reasons Clemson rolled past UNC for first ACC win

Related Topics: Clemson, Dabo Swinney, Adam Randall

Clemson rebounded from back-to-back losses with an easy 38-10 victory at North Carolina on Saturday. The Tigers (2-3 overall, 1-2 ACC) used a massive first half, rolling up 367 yards in the first 30 minutes and finishing with 488 total yards on the day, while giving up just 270 to the Tar Heels (2-3, 0-1).

The defense got off the field, the special teams did their job, and the offense took advantage of a struggling UNC defense. It was the most complete performance Clemson has had this year. Here are three reasons why the Tigers dominated:

Explosive plays

Huge chunk yards came early and often for Clemson.
